Shillong (also Shilong ) is the capital of the Indian state of Meghalaya. The place is located in the Khasibergen to about 1500 meters above sea level and has about 143,000 inhabitants ( 2011 census ). It is the administrative seat of the district of East Khasi Hills and houses a university, a seismological observatory, pharmaceutical industry and is archbishopric.

From 1874 to 1972, the elimination of the state of Meghalaya from Assam, Shillong was the capital of Assam. Shillong is particularly damp and gloomy during monsoon, as it lies in the region with the world's greatest rainfall.
